WebDec 1, 2015 · Grounding must be green, green and yellow, or bare. Any color other than that can be used as ungrounded (hot) (black, red, blue, pink, purple, etc.). Grounded (neutral) wires can be used as ungrounded (hot) conductors, but only if they are marked at both ends. Grounding conductors can only be used as grounding conductors.

They are more commonly used as travelers in three- or four-way switches and in some lights and fans. chili\u0027s nashville tnWebMar 10, 2024 · A black or red-hot wire usually connects to a brass-colored screw terminal or black wire lead on electrical devices. A white neutral wire usually connects to a silver-colored terminal or white wire lead.
